The Galeon 435 GTO is a 44-foot express cruiser that was launched by the award-winning Polish yacht-building firm Galeon in 2023. This super-sleek and ultra-sporty vessel boasts a faceted bow entry, geometric curves and masses of dark-toned glazing for a thoroughly modern look, while breezy living spaces with a contemporary vibe deliver the perfect blend of versatility and comfort. Well suited for multi-day island-hopping tours thanks to spacious lower-deck accommodation, the 435 GTO also benefits from a rugged fiberglass hull and four beefy outboards for a swift and reliable cruising experience.
Head beyond a skipper’s door built into the sloping windscreen to access a chic bow lounge lined in striped grey teak and multi-toned upholstery with a demure and understated appeal. Up here you can expect a cozy C-shaped sofa tracing the contours of the gunwale with cushioned backrests, under-seat storage and the ability to transform this space into one sprawling daybed. There’s even more space on the aft-deck, where a transom rumble seat can be exploited for its stern-facing views or turned around to use during lunch at a removable timber-lined dining table. There’s also a pair of bathing platforms back here, either side of the outboards, where you can dive into the crystal-clear waters to enjoy refreshing salt-water swims. Need a little extra room? Fold-down bulwarks back here dramatically increase the amount of livable space to aft, with these innovative features perfect for use as floating cocktail terraces or dive platforms. Structural flares added to the hard-top, meanwhile, hang over these terraces to offer best-in-class shade as you relax. Optional extras in this al-fresco space include six rod-holders and fish storage for casual fishers, a swim ladder, a transom shower and a slide-out chill-box to keep your drinks crisp and cool.
A set of sliding glass doors welcomes guests into a stylish salon with a fully-equipped galley to port featuring everything needed for gourmet meals and a U-shaped dining sofa for up to five positioned to starboard. This space benefits from neutral toned furnishings, grey timber surrounds, cresting wave side windows and an awe-inspiring curved sunroof that arches above the helm to provide natural light and opens up at the touch of a button for an atmospheric and elemental vibe. The helm station is positioned to starboard and boasts a triple-set of piloting seats with arm-rests, power-steering, touch-screen devices and the very latest in navigational equipment.
A glazed companionway door leads down to a lower-deck with a spacious lobby that can be used as a lower-galley and a starboard head with an enclosed waterfall shower stall and stone-effect surfaces. To aft there is a cabin with a double bed and a single bed, along with hanging lockers and a bedside cabinet, while towards the bow there is a private master cabin with a queen-sized bed and two full-height closets.
Powered by four 500HP Mercury outboard gasoline motors, you can expect pulsating top speeds that will outstrip your peers and efficient cruising speeds that will encourage you to stay out on the water for long weekends thanks to a 528-gallon fuel tank.
